About

As an experienced member of our Software Engineering Group, you'll apply your expertise to solving business problems through innovation and engineering practices. You should be a self-starter willing to learn various full-stack technologies and show ownership on the application portfolio. We operate on principles of technical excellence and strong partnership with the business to ensure that the company can rely on our ability to deliver robust technology solutions to emerging business needs, continued growth and competitive advantage.

This role requires a wide variety of strengths and capabilities, including:
* Full-stack software engineer with experience designing and developing web applications and supporting services using Agile and XP practices
* Partnering with the product owner and business to understand new requirements and designing modules/functionality to address user's needs
* Manage the Software Development Life Cycle for all application modules
* Mindset to work with highly sensitive data and appropriate controls framework
* Proactively looks to develop, implement and further best practices across the group
* Works well with others and understands the importance of the team
* Strong oral and written communication skills
* Awareness of the overall business and IT strategy
* SRE related skills to ensure that our app is operationally optimized

Desired Qualifications
* Strong computer science fundamentals such as algorithms, data structures, multithreading, object-oriented development, distributed applications, client-server/service oriented architecture, cloud architecture, automated testing
* Excellent knowledge of Java technologies including core Java 8, Spring, Apache, J2EE with 5+ years experience
* JavaScript, HTML, CSS development skills with 3+ years experience
* Database development skills including SQL, relational data design and stored procedures with 3+ years experience
* RESTful API design, microservice oriented architecture expertise
* Performance/Load testing
* Test Café/Selenium/Cucumber/JUnit or other automated testing frameworks
* Cloud Foundry
* Graph technologies (Neo4j, Apache Jena, SPARQL, RDF)
* NLP Libraries (Stanford NLP, GATE)
* Integration technologies experience such as middleware message queues (UMQ or Kafka)
* SVG visualisations using libraries such as d3.js
* Experience applying machine learning methods to products, features and/or services
* Experience with analytics tools and charting components like Adobe Analytics
* ElasticSearch/Apache Lucene/Apache Solr
* Legal domain knowledge and experience.

Preferred Qualifications:
* Knowledge of Java 8+
* Object-oriented and MVC JavaScript experience
* Knowledge of UI Frameworks such as React and Angular
* CI/CD using tools such as Jenkins and experience developing cloud native experience applications
* Transactional database development experience and performance tuning, such as Oracle
* TDD experience
* Pair Programming experience
* Knowledge of Shell scripting such as Bash
* Spring Boot
* Maven
